#49fd73 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#49fd73 is composed of 28.6% red, 99.2%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 54.5%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 134 degrees, a saturation of 97.8% and a lightness of 63.9%. #49fd73 color hex could be obtained by blending #92ffe6 with #00fb00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

#49fd73 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#49fd73 has RGB values of R:73, G:253, B:115 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0, Y:0.55,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 4849011.

Shades and Tints of #49fd73

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000c03 is the darkest color, while #f8fff9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#49fd73

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9ea8a0 is the less saturated color, while #49fd73 is the most saturated one.
